Notes: Complicated case as a number of people from the McLean family accused. There may have been some family rivalry between the McLeans and Chisholms and the Chisholms wanted to acquire the lands belonging to the group. Claimed that the McLeans had been 'kindly tenants' for several hundred years.

Case Notes
One of a group of 15 related to the McLeans who were accused of witchcraft by the Chisholms.
